Graphs!

In Maths we have been learning about graphs. We built our own graph to show our favourite animals. We can discuss which animal is the favourite and which animal is the least favourite. We are learning to total different groups and find the difference between the different groups of animals.

Our Glasgow City Sight-Seeing Trip.

Primary 2 had such an amazing day on our bus trip around Glasgow. We saw lots of famous sights including the River Clyde which we have been learning about this term. We saw some famous ships that were built on the Clyde as well as some well known Clydeside buildings that sit there today.

We  loved being on the open-top bus and we have learned more about our city.
